Redondo-Lopez had his initial appearance yesterday before United States Magistrate Judge Eric J. Markovich. On …Not all immigration checkpoints are at the border, either. The Border Patrol is legally allowed to check individuals within 100 miles of borders. As a result, the Border Patrol has established some immigration checkpoints well North of the United States and Mexico border. The …Some residents of Arivaca, Arizona, have stated they are regularly subjected to harassment, delays, searches, and racial profiling at the internal checkpoint near their community. They questioned the effectiveness of the checkpoint, and began monitoring it in 2014 to determine its effectiveness. ( NewsNation) — In a new strategy to handle the recent influx of migrants at the southern border, Customs and Border Protection officials are closing some checkpoints in Texas and Arizona to reassign agents to areas that need more support.
